What is a tie pin for?

The rule is simple: It goes between the third and fourth buttons of your dress shirt." "It may sound obvious, but a tie bar doesn't just clip the front end of your tie to the back end. It fastens both ends to the placket of your shirt." "Finally, never wear a tie bar that's wider than your tie.

Furthermore, what is the purpose of a tie clip? A tie clip or tie bar is a small piece of metal designed for use with a tie. Its purpose is to keep your tie in place by securing it to your shirt placket. Today, however, tie clips are also used for aesthetic reasons, such as adding a fashionable accent to an outfit.

Similarly, it is asked, what are tie pins called?

A tie pin (or tiepin, also known as a stick pin/stickpin) is a neckwear-controlling device, originally worn by wealthy English gentlemen to secure the folds of their cravats. Do tie pins damage ties?

If you use a tie pin it will damage your shirt and necktie unless it is very loosely woven. You could use a tie bar if you want something that makes a statement and is visible or you can use a tie restraint like tiealign or others that will keep your necktie in place without being seen when used.

What is the difference between a tie clip and tie bar?

Tie Clip: Is a bar of metal which clips the tie to the underlying shirt. A tie clip opens like a jaw to grasp the tie while a tie bar slides across the tie. While the tie clip has a jaw which opens and closes a tie bar slides over the tie and shirt. Tie Pin: A metal tack which pierces through the tie.

How far down should a tie go?

As a general rule for all tie knots, the widest part of your tie should hang roughly at the same height as the upper edge of your leather belt, with the tie's tip extending slightly below it. The tip of the narrow end would then hang wherever it may.

Can you wear a collar bar with any shirt?

Collar Bar In order to wear it with a shirt, you need to have holes in your collar so you can poke them through. Unfortunately, it's very difficult to find these shirts and usually, you have to go custom.

How do you hide a tie tail?

Make sure it's within an inch or so above/below your belt buckle. Then, if the skinny end is too long, tuck it in using one of these methods: The Tuck – Simply tuck the skinny end of your tie into your shirt. This works best if you tuck it inside the first button above your waist line.
